Xavier Frissant Les roses du Clos 2016

This rare cousin of Sauvignon (also known as Sauvignon Rose and Surin Gris), which is tinted like
Gewurztraminer, when ripe renders in Frissant’s hands a wine of surprising substance and authority.
Fermented in old 400 litre barrels, it is quite unmarked by wood flavours but offers an excellent texture. It has
developed quite a following for its dramatic, almost exotic nose of roses and mastic. It is lively, dry and spicy,
brimming with vigor and animation. This new vintage has exceptional cut and focus.
